The White House answered the question about the possible visit of Biden to Ukraine

White House Deputy Press Secretary Karine Jean-Pierre said that US President Joe Biden has no plans to visit Ukraine yet, despite the invitation of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ky. She announced this at a briefing, TASS reports.

“At this time, I don’t have any travel plans that I can announce or that I can pre-announce,” she said.

Earlier, Zelensky, during a telephone conversation with his American colleague Joe Biden, invited him to visit Ukraine.

It is noted that there was no positive response from Biden. The interlocutor of the channel noted that the visit of the American president to Kiev against the backdrop of the current crisis is extremely unlikely.

Prior to this, the Presidents of the United States and Ukraine, Joe Biden and Volodymyr Zelensky, had a telephone conversation. The parties discussed the situation on the Russian-Ukrainian border.

Biden reaffirmed the US commitment to Ukraine's sovereignty and territorial integrity and signaled that Washington, along with its allies and partners, would respond quickly and decisively to any further Russian aggression against Ukraine.
